About this role

You will work as a Registered Nurse in the Medical-Surgical unit at WVU Weirton Medical Center. This is a 91-day travel assignment starting August 19, 2026, with 3x12-hour night shifts (7:00 PM to 7:00 AM). You will earn $2,229.12 per week.

Role and Responsibilities

  • Provide direct patient care with nurse-to-patient ratios of 1:6–8 on night shifts
  • Titrate medications including heparin, bumex, and lasix; cardiac drip titration is not required
  • Monitor telemetry alerts provided by the dedicated monitor technician on level 5; you are not expected to read or interpret strips independently
  • Work with patient care technicians who assist with vitals, blood glucose monitoring, EKGs, heart monitor application, bathing, feeding, toileting, and turning
  • Coordinate with respiratory therapy for breathing treatments, inhalers, ABGs, and respiratory equipment management
  • Chart using the EPIC system
  • May float to other Med-Surg, Med-Surg Telemetry, or IMC units for lower acuity patients

Schedule

  • Every other weekend required
  • No on-call or standby requirements
  • May be asked to participate in holiday rotation
  • Rotating shifts typically include 2 weeks of days followed by 2 weeks of nights
  • Unit manager manages your schedule with consideration for requested time off; flexibility to fill staffing gaps is expected

Requirements

  • Minimum 1 year of nursing experience; first-time travelers are accepted
  • Current RN license and BLS certification
  • BSN is not required
  • Must reside outside a 50-mile radius; unexpired driver's license required at submission
  • Any licensing hits must be disclosed at submission

Unit Details

Common diagnoses include pneumonia, UTI, altered mental status, GI bleed, alcohol withdrawal, and falls/weakness. Patient care techs are available at a ratio of approximately 1:10–12. Wear navy blue scrubs.
